Architectural engineering is a unique field that encompasses both engineering and architecture. It involves the use of technical and scientific principles to plan, design, and build structures that are safe, efficient, and aesthetically pleasing. According to the National Society of Professional Engineers (NSPE), “Architectural engineers must understand the impact of all design decisions on the safety, efficiency, and aesthetics of the built environment.”

The process of designing and constructing a structure can be extremely complex, involving many different steps and stakeholders. An architectural engineer is responsible for understanding the various processes involved in creating a structure and ensuring that they are completed safely and efficiently. This includes assessing the site and existing conditions, evaluating materials and components, analyzing structural integrity, and considering environmental and energy-efficiency factors.

In addition to the technical aspects of designing a structure, an architectural engineer must also consider the aesthetic appeal of the finished product. This includes choosing materials and colors that complement the existing surroundings, as well as understanding how light, shadow, and scale can affect the overall look and feel of the space. The architectural engineer must also be able to work with other professionals, such as architects, landscape architects, and interior designers, to ensure that the final product meets all of the stakeholders’ needs and expectations.

Becoming an Architectural Engineer: Educational Requirements and Professional Opportunities

To become an architectural engineer, you will need to complete a four-year bachelor’s degree in architectural engineering or a related field. This type of degree program typically includes courses in mathematics, physics, chemistry, engineering, and design. You may also be required to complete additional coursework in areas such as construction management, construction law, and economics.

In addition to completing a bachelor’s degree, you may also choose to pursue a master’s degree in architectural engineering. A master’s degree program typically focuses on more advanced topics such as building codes, regulations, and computer-aided design software. Many universities also offer certificate programs in architectural engineering that can help you develop specific skills and knowledge.

Once you have completed your education, there are a variety of professional opportunities available to you. You may choose to work as a consultant or contractor, helping to design and construct buildings. You may also find employment with government agencies or private companies, working on projects such as airports, bridges, and highways. There are also opportunities to teach and conduct research in the field of architectural engineering.

The Benefits of Hiring an Architectural Engineer for Your Construction Project

Hiring an architectural engineer for your construction project can provide a number of benefits. An experienced engineer can help you identify potential design problems and provide solutions that will improve the efficiency and safety of the structure. They can also help you save money by utilizing technology to reduce labor costs and identifying cost-effective materials and components.

An architectural engineer can also help you ensure that your structure meets all applicable safety standards and regulations. They will be familiar with local building codes and can make sure that your project complies with them. Additionally, an architectural engineer can help you implement sustainable practices into your design, such as using renewable materials and incorporating energy-efficient features.

What Does an Architectural Engineer Do? A Look at Their Responsibilities and Skills

As an architectural engineer, you will be responsible for a variety of tasks throughout the design and construction process. You will need to be able to identify design problems and develop effective solutions. You will also need to be familiar with building codes and regulations, as well as local zoning laws. Additionally, you will need to be proficient in using computer-aided design (CAD) software to create detailed plans and drawings.

You will also need to be able to work with a variety of different professionals, including architects, contractors, and engineers. As an architectural engineer, you will need to be able to communicate effectively with these individuals and collaborate to ensure that the project is completed safely, efficiently, and within budget.

How Does Architectural Engineering Enhance Safety and Efficiency in Building Design?

Architectural engineering plays a crucial role in enhancing safety and efficiency in building design. An experienced architectural engineer can identify potential risks associated with a structure and develop strategies to mitigate them. For example, they can assess the structural integrity of a building and recommend additional reinforcements if needed.

An architectural engineer can also leverage technology to improve efficiency. This includes utilizing CAD software to create accurate plans and drawings, as well as using simulations to test out various scenarios and identify the optimal design. Additionally, an architectural engineer can help you implement sustainable practices, such as using renewable materials and incorporating energy-efficient features, to reduce energy consumption and minimize waste.
